HUNTINGTON BEACH, Calif. - Clockwork Home Services Inc. (Clockwork) awarded multiple franchises at its 2006 franchisee awards program during the company’s annual franchise congress. The awards event honored top performers in its One Hour Air Conditioning & Heating (One Hour) and Benjamin Franklin Plumbing (Benjamin Franklin) franchises.

The company’s top honor, Franchisee of the Year, was to awarded: Gabe and Michelle Wade, owner’s of Triple Service One Hour, Mendota, Ill.; John Fontano, general manager of Clockwork-owned One Hour A/C & Heating, Winter Haven, Fla.; and Hallam Cottingham, owner of Benjamin Franklin Plumbing, Greenville, S.C.

Fastest Growing Franchise award winners included: James and Lori Larson, owners of First Response One Hour, Orem, Utah; John Fontano, general manager of Clockwork-owned One Hour A/C & Heating, Winter Haven, Fla.; and Hallam Cottingham, Benjamin Franklin Plumbing, Greenville, S.C.

Clockwork also recognized franchisees for their excellence in employee training, recruitment, and retention with an Employer of Choice award. The 2006 Employer of Choice awards went to: Mike Fowler and Dan King, Dan King’s One Hour, Charlotte, N.C.; Bruce Cook and Vaughn Goettler, 21 Degrees One Hour, Kingston, Ontario; Dave and Rosann Kempker, Benjamin Franklin Plumbing, Jefferson City, Mo.; and Scott Brinkley, Benjamin Franklin Plumbing, Hendersonville, Tenn.

The Spirit Award for community service was presented to franchisees for their exceptional performance in community service and the Transformation Award was presented for improvements made to their business in a 12-month period.

Spirit Award recipients included: McCarthy’s One Hour Air Conditioning, Omaha, Neb., and Doug and Wayne Loranger, Benjamin Franklin Plumbing, Pompton Lakes, N.J. The Transformation awards were given to: Tim Bartman’s One Hour, Monongahela, Pa., and Jeanne and Thomas Hutson’s Benjamin Franklin Plumbing, Marion, Iowa.
